Long haul transport duty didn't provide much in the way of excitement, but the pay was good. That suited Roadhammer just fine; he had never been much for excitement. He just wanted a safe gig that would keep him supplied with energon, and dragging rebuilding supplies from Iacon out into the smaller Autobot cities did just that.
The company could be better, though...
Autobot Security had been fairly adamant that the convoy wasn't going to cross the Tygun Span unprotected, what with it being a vast, unoccupied wasteland and their cargo being highly valuable and highly dangerous military equipment. The half-dozen ISS officers escorting them weren't the problem, though. The problem was the other transport driver.
"I hope we get some sort of action along the way," Jackknife said, as if on cue. "This run has been boring as the Pit so far."
"You said that ten minutes ago," Roadhammer reminded him. "And you'd better pray we don't get any action, considering what's inside that trailer of yours. If we do, we'll be running for cover while the soldiers do all the fighting."
"Killjoy."
Roadhammer considered replying, but decided it was better to just let the conversation die. He drove on for a while, eventually passing a sign that said:
NOW ENTERING THE TYGUN SPAN
PRAETORUS WHARF: 97 HIC
NOVA CRONUM: 132 HIC
